We have an exciting opportunity for an experienced and highly organised Personal Assistant to provide support to our Hospital Director at Clifton Park Hospital.
The role:
We are seeking a highly motivated, proactive individual with exceptional Personal Assistant (PA) skills to provide a streamlined service to the Hospital Director and the Senior Management Team at Clifton Park Hospital. The role includes diary management, organisation of meetings, and minute taking.
The role requires utilisation of an in-house training risk management and patient administration system, for which training will be provided. It also involves co-ordinating patient complaints, including logging on the system, investigating where appropriate, collating responses, and conducting complaint review meetings.
Working closely with the Hospital Director, the successful candidate will manage the end-to-end credentialing requirements of consultants, ensuring compliance with Ramsay Health Care UK standards. Responsibilities include maintaining existing consultants' credentials and onboarding new consultants with practicing privileges, liaising with Hospital Senior Leadership, Corporate Senior Leadership, and the Medical Advisory Committee (MAC).

About us:
Ramsay Health Care UK is a well-established global hospital group with over 60 years’ experience, operating in 8 countries with 88,000 staff treating 8 million patients annually. We are respected within the healthcare industry and are a leading provider of independent hospital services in England, with strong NHS relationships.
We value a positive, “can do” attitude and support our employees' training and development to ensure high standards of clinical care, patient safety, dignity, and confidentiality. Our culture is built around “People caring for People”, and our staff are our greatest asset.
